Baliya
Baliya is a village located in Bansgaon tehsil of Gorakhp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 23km away from sub-district headquarter Bansgaon (tehsildar office) and 46km away from district headquarter Gorakhpur. As per 2009 stats, Baliya village is also a gram panchayat.

About Baliya
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Baliya is 186290. The village spans a total geographical area of 34 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 273412. Gorakhpur is nearest town to Baliya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 46km away.

Population of Baliya
Below is a concise population overview of Baliya as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 894 | 423 | 471 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 118 | 53 | 65 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 244 | 110 | 134 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 589 | 333 | 256 |
Illiterate Population | 305 | 90 | 215 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Baliya village:
- The total population of Baliya village is around 894, including approximately 423 males and 471 females, with a sex ratio of 1113 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 118 children aged 0–6 years in Baliya village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Baliya village has 244 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Baliya village is about 65.88%, with male literacy at 78.72% and female literacy at 54.35%.
- There are around 136 households in Baliya village.
Connectivity of Baliya
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Baliya. As per the 2011 stats, Baliya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
